Moses Bradstreet Bradford*; b. Apr. 20, 1799, Francestown NH; d. Sep. 23, 1878, McIndoes Falls VT.
- m1. Ascenath Church Dickman* (1796-1840), on Nov. 25, 1829, Northfield MA.
- Moses Bradstreet and Ascenath Church had 4 children:
- Sarah Ann Bradford; b. Sep. 20, 1830, Montague MA; d. Sep. 11, 1878, Worcester MA.
- m. Jonathan Francis Whipple on Oct. 11, 1853 in Medway MA. He was born on Oct. 11, 1828, Medway MA. They had four children who all died before any opportunity to produce further generations: Helen Whipple (1854-1856) in NYC, who died young; Jennie Frances Whipple (1855-1855) in Bridgeport CT, who also died young; George Cheever Whipple (1858-1878) of NYC, who died at about 20 years of age; and Henry Washburn Whipple (1863-1889) of NYC, who died at 26 years of age, and was buried in Westboro MA.
- Maria Cushman Bradford; b. July 21, 1833, Grafton VT; d. Jan. 18, 1909, Buffalo NY.
- m. Thomas Denny Demond on Sep. 25, 1851 in Grafton VT. He was born Apr. 22, 1827, Ware MA; d. June 18, 1899, Buffalo NY. They had a daughter, Lucia Almira Demond; b. Aug. 18, 1859, Montague MA; d. Feb. 17, 1941, East Aurora NY.
- James Henry Bradford* (1836-1913)
- Helen Ascenath Bradford; b. June 19, 1840, Grafton VT; d. Dec. 17, 1901, Buffalo NY. According to Bradford Stone, "She grew up an unruly and difficult child not well adjusted to life. This was augmented by an unhappy love affair." She married on her 43rd. birthday, June 19, 1883, in Buffalo. She had no children, and they were later divorced.
- m. John H. Pettingill; b. Nov. 23, 1840, Grafton VT.
- m2. Martha Mehitable Green (1807-1902) on July 17, 1843. She is the daughter of Levi Green; b. Nov. 6, 1767, of Westmoreland NH, and Martha Earl; b. June 22, 1774, of Boston MA.
- Moses Bradstreet and Martha Mehitable had 3 children:
- Martha Elizabeth Earl Bradford; b. Nov. 22, 1845, Grafton VT. She graduated from Mt. Holyoke College in 1869 and taught Greek, first in a girl's school in St. Johns, New Brunswick, Canada, and later at Mt. Holyoke.
- m. Dr. James Oscar Gilchrist, M.D.; b. Aug. 8, 1849, McIndoes Falls VT; d. Jan 2, 1933, Rutland VT; where he is buried. Dr. Gilchrist graduated from Dartmouth College in 1871 and received his M.D. from Long Island Hospital College in 1874. The Gilchrists lived in Peacham VT, where they had a daughter:
- Beth Gilchrist, b. Apr. 14, 1879. Beth, was a frequent corespondent with, and half-cousin to Faith Bradford (1880-1970), the author of the Bradford genealogy from which much of this material is drawn. There are many personal memories and anecdotal stories in her work which includes a brief appendix on the Gilchrist family.
- Mary Cleveland Bradford; b. Apr. 23, 1847, Grafton VT; d. Nov. 24, 1927. She graduated from Mt. Holyoke College in 1871, then taught Latin there for 13 years followed by a year of research at Yale. Although once engaged to be married, the man to whom she was betrothed, died of tuberculosis. She never married. Afterward her year at Yale, she taught at a school in Canada and later served as a chaperone at a girl's school in Chevy Chase MD. She died in her sister, Martha's, home in Rutland VT.
- Moses Bradstreet Bradford, Jr.; b. Nov. 8, 1849, Grafton VT; d. Oct. 17, 1935, Buffalo NY. He graduated from the Sheffield Scientific School of Yale in 1975. He joined the firm of Barnes & Bancroft, a Buffalo department store, formed by his brother-in-law, William Bancroft who returned from Europe after the Civil War. After William Bancroft died in 1881, the store became Hengerer & Co. and Moses Bradstreet Bradford, Jr. became its chief financial officer for the rest of his working life. - m. Harriet Lucinda Lord on Sep. 25, 1883 in Buffalo NY. She was b. Jan. 6, 1853, Shelter Island, L.I., NY, d. Apr. 7, 1928, Buffalo NY and buried there. Harriet's parents were Daniel Minor Lord (1800-1861), b. in Lyme CT, and Eliza Ann Hardy (1807-1899), b. in Chatham, MA. Faith Bradford included a brief appendix on the Lord family in her genealogy.
Moses B. Bradford, Jr. and Harriet had a daughter:
- Elise Lord; b. Dec. 27, 1888 in Buffalo NY.
Brief Biography:
Moses Bradstreet Bradford* (1799-1878) was born at Francestown NH, prepared for college at the Kimball Union Academy, followed by Pembroke, both in New Hampshire. He then entered Amherst College (MA) in 1821 and graduated in 1825. He was the 31st person to have graduate from Amherst College. After graduation from Amherst, he studied theology with the Rev. Theophilus Packard (1802-1885) of Shelburne MA from 1825-27 (The 7th person to graduate from Amherst).
Moses Bradstreet Bradford received his M.A. from Amherst in 1828, and was licensed to preach as a "candidate" by the Windham Association of Halifax VT, where he trained for about a year. He was ordained on Nov. 19, 1829 at Montague MA by the Rev. Heman Humphrey D.D., President of Amherst. He served as the preacher at the Congregational Church in Montague for three years, 1828-32 and was the Pastor at the Congregational Church in Grafton, VT from 1832 to 1859. His installation at Grafton on Oct. 31, 1832, was overseen by the Rev. John Wheeler D.D. Rev. Wheeler was then Pastor at Windsor, and subsequently President of the University of Vermont.
The biographical record for Moses Bradstreet Bradford in the Amherst College Biographical Record 1821-1939, indicates that he married Mrs. Asenath C. Ewers on Nov. 5, 1829. Note that the spelling of her name (without a "c" following the "s") and the marriage date (by 20 days) are at variance with the genealogies compiled by Faith Bradford, and subsequently copied by Bradford Stone. The Amherst Record also shows that her father, Thomas Dickman, died in Greenfield MA, on July 26, 1840, rather than Dec. 9, 1841, as listed by Faith Bradford.
Moses Bradstreet Bradford. married a second time after Ascenath's death in 1840. His second wife, whom he married on July 17, 1843, was Martha Mehitable Green (1807-1902), daughter of Levi Green of Westmoreland, NH. Martha was a descendant of a long line of the Putnam family (her maternal grandmother was Mehitable Putnam)
